What Amenities Can I Expect at I-95 Rest Stops?
The amenities available at I-95 rest stops vary depending on location and state. However, most offer a range of essential services, including:
- Restrooms: Clean and well-maintained restrooms are a standard feature at all rest stops.
- Parking: Ample parking space for cars, trucks, and sometimes even RVs.
- Picnic Areas: Designated areas with tables and benches for enjoying a packed lunch or snack.
- Information Centers: Some rest stops have information centers providing maps, brochures, and local tourism information.
Are there Different Types of I-95 Rest Stops?
Yes, the types of rest stops along I-95 can differ. You might encounter:
- State-maintained rest areas: These are usually funded and managed by the individual state's Department of Transportation. Amenities can vary based on the state's budget and priorities.
- Privately-owned rest stops: Some rest stops are operated by private companies, often offering more extensive amenities, such as restaurants or convenience stores, but potentially at a higher cost.
It is also important to distinguish between rest areas (typically offering basic services) and travel plazas (which usually feature more extensive services like gas stations, restaurants, and shops).
